I came here to study Radiography as that is an occupation on the demand list and I guessed it would stay there too. My husband could work 20hrs a week but he has a business in UK so still works for that, the downside being that he spends a lot of time in the UK, but we thought the sacrifice would be worth it.
University fees are expensive for international students, I think nursing is about $8000 per semester, but don't hold me to that. If you look at individual uni websited you can find the fees they charge.
I am now studying accounting because I now have Permanent Residency and didn't particularly want to be a radiographer anyway, so I am sorted now.
